index.blade.php 7.1 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171172173
  1. @extends('vip.layouts')
  2. @section('seo_title')
  3. {{ trans('menu.Rechargedrawals') }}
  4. @endsection
  5. @section('content')
  6. <style>
  7. .layui-laydate-range {
  8. width: auto;
  9. }
  10. .layui-form-switch em {
  11. width: auto;
  12. }
  13. .layui-form-switch {
  14. width: 44px;
  15. line-height: 23px;
  16. }
  17. .layui-form-item .checkbox {
  18. width: auto;
  19. }
  20. </style>
  21. <script type="text/html" id="created_at">
  22. @{{#if((new Date().getTime()-new Date(d.created_at))>24*60*60*1000){ }}
  23. @{{d.created_at}}
  24. <div style="color: red;">红包已超过24小时</div>
  25. @{{#}else{ }}
  26. @{{d.created_at}}
  27. @{{#} }}
  28. </script>
  29. <div class="layui-row">
  30. <div class="layui-col-xs12">
  31. <form class="layui-form rewrite" action="" eventType=eventForm>
  32. <div class="layui-form-item">
  33. <div class="layui-inline">
  34. <div class="layui-inline">
  35. <label class="layui-form-label">红包订单号</label>
  36. <div class="layui-input-inline">
  37. <input type="text" name="lm_order_id" id="lm_order_id" lay-verify="" autocomplete="off" class="layui-input" eventType=event-query value="{{ $lm_order_id }}">
  38. </div>
  39. </div>
  40. <div class="layui-inline">
  41. <label class="layui-form-label">红包发起者</label>
  42. <div class="layui-input-inline">
  43. <input type="text" name="account" id="account" lay-verify="" autocomplete="off" class="layui-input" eventType=event-query value="{{ $account }}">
  44. </div>
  45. </div>
  46. <div class="layui-inline">
  47. <label class="layui-form-label">时间范围:</label>
  48. <div class="layui-input-inline">
  49. <input type="text" name="start_time" eventType="event-query" placeholder="开始时间" value="{{ $start_time }}" autocomplete="off" class="layui-input test-item">
  50. </div>
  51. <div class="layui-input-inline">
  52. <input type="text" name="end_time" eventType="event-query" placeholder="结束时间" value="{{ $end_time }}" autocomplete="off" class="layui-input test-item">
  53. </div>
  54. </div>
  55. <div class="layui-inline" style="width: 300px">
  56. <label class="layui-form-label">红包类型</label>
  57. <div class="layui-input-inline" style="width: 200px">
  58. <select name="type" id="form_group" lay-verify="" autocomplete="off" class="layui-input" eventType=event-query>
  59. <option value="-1">请选择红包类型</option>
  60. <option value="0" @if($type=='0')selected="selected" @endif>拼手气红包</option>
  61. <option value="1" @if($type=='1')selected="selected" @endif>普通红包</option>
  62. </select>
  63. </div>
  64. </div>
  65. <div class="layui-inline">
  66. <a class="layui-btn layui-btn-sm lay-btn-diy" eventType=event-query-submit data-type="reload" style="opacity: 1; pointer-events: auto;"
  67. >提交</a>
  68. <a class="layui-btn layui-btn-sm layui-btn-normal reset" data-type="reload" style="opacity: 1; pointer-events: auto;" type="" href="" >重置</a>
  69. <a class="layui-btn layui-btn-sm layui-btn-green set" data-type="reload" style="opacity: 1; pointer-events: auto;" href="javascript:window.location.reload()">
  70. <i class="layui-icon">ဂ</i>
  71. </a>
  72. <!-- <a href="#" class="layui-btn layui-btn-sm">一键退还</a> -->
  73. @if(checkRriv('/admin/Refund/delete'))<a href="javascript:;" class="layui-btn layui-btn-sm layui-btn-danger backwater">一键退还</a>@endif
  74. </div>
  75. <!--<div class="layui-inline">
  76. <a href="/admin/redbag/addRedBag" class="layui-btn layui-btn-sm ">添加红包</a>
  77. </div>
  78. <div class="layui-inline">
  79. <a href="/admin/redbag/giveDemo" class="layui-btn layui-btn-sm ">导出红包示例</a>
  80. </div>-->
  81. </div>
  82. </div>
  83. </form>
  84. </div>
  85. </div>
  86. @push('dataTableJS')
  87. $('.backwater').on('click',function(){
  88. var checkStatus = table.checkStatus('{{ $dataId }}')
  89. ,data = checkStatus.data;
  90. //var arr=JSON.stringify(data);
  91. var return_point = $('#return_point').val();
  92. var s_time= $('#form_star_time').val();
  93. var e_time=$('#form_end_time').val();
  94. /*var game=$('#form_gametype').val()*/
  95. var url='/admin/Refund/delete?star_time='+s_time+'&end_time='+e_time;/*+'&game='+game*/
  96. if(data.length!==0){
  97. layer.open({
  98. type: 1,
  99. btn: ['确定', '取消'],
  100. btnAlign: 'c',
  101. id: 'box',
  102. content: '<p style="height: 40px;line-height: 40px;font-size: 20px;text-align: center">确定提交</p>', //这里content是一个DOM,注意:最好该元素要存放在body最外层,否则可能被其它的相对元素所影响
  103. yes: function (index, layero) {
  104. layer.close(index);
  105. var msgIndex = parent.layer.msg('数据处理中...', {
  106. icon: 16,
  107. shade: 0.71
  108. });
  109. $.ajax({
  110. type:'post',
  111. url:url,
  112. data:{data:data,return_point:return_point},
  113. dataType:'json',
  114. success:function(json){
  115. layer.close(msgIndex);
  116. layer.msg(json.msg)
  117. reloadDataTable();
  118. },
  119. error:function(){
  120. console.log('链接失败');
  121. }
  122. })
  123. }
  124. });
  125. }else{
  126. layer.msg('请选择条目数')
  127. }
  128. })
  129. // $('.lay-btn-diy').on('click', function(){
  130. // var type = $(this).data('type');
  131. // active[type] ? active[type].call(this) : '';
  132. // });
  133. //重置表单
  134. $('.reset').on('click',function(){
  135. $('input').val('');
  136. $('#name').val('');
  137. // var type = $(this).data('type');
  138. // active[type] ? active[type].call(this) : '';
  139. });
  140. //刷新表单
  141. $('.set').on('click',function(){
  142. // var type = $(this).data('type');
  143. // active[type] ? active[type].call(this) : '';
  144. });
  145. @endpush
  146. @include('vip.datatable')
  147. @endsection